Output 171885c347994970191cecbfea1fd5fa20c19c9b98731405ca3a66e2f8d4fc2a:1

value
997530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db1fb2300fc6f45c3c0e86025eeffd4a98c1b5a OP_EQUAL
address
3D9dbroP8QQP29EDW9MzCj5zuVctQUnMvq
transaction
171885c347994970191cecbfea1fd5fa20c19c9b98731405ca3a66e2f8d4fc2a
confirmations
343628
spent
true